About Consort Crescent
Consort Crescent is a residential area in Burlington, Ontario, known for its family-friendly atmosphere, well-maintained homes, and proximity to various amenities. The neighborhood offers a mix of detached and semi-detached houses, with tree-lined streets and a quiet suburban feel. It is conveniently located near schools, parks, shopping centers, and cultural attractions, making it an ideal place for families and professionals alike.
Features
Proximity to Lake Ontario - Consort Crescent is just a short drive from the scenic shores of Lake Ontario, offering beautiful waterfront parks and trails.
Access to Major Highways - The area provides easy access to major highways like the QEW and Highway 403, making commuting to Toronto or Hamilton convenient.
